Holmes stunner not enough for U-23s

AUCKLAND, New Zealand - Auckland City FC U-23 and Melville United U-23 shared the spoils after an entertaining 2-2 draw at Auckland Grammar School today.

The Navy Blues U-23s opened the scoring when Will Eng headed home from a corner only for Leslie Kivolyn to equalise five minutes later.

The match became bogged down between the penalty areas after that until Thomas Holmes lashed home a beautiful long range goal with 15 minutes left.

That strike appeared to hand the home team victory until Shaun Ledley levelled from the penalty spot after Louie Danielson brought down a Melville United U-23 player.

That was a hammerblow for Kris Bright's side who very nearly ended up losing the match but for a brilliant last minute save by Finn Dockerty.

"It was a fair result but Melville had the better of us in the first half.

"We made some changes to our shape at the break and we created a lot more chances.

"We should have put the game to bed after Thomas' (Holmes) goal but individual errors cost us at the end.

"In fairness, Melville United are a very good team, they kept the ball very very well.

"They're very well structured and Sam Wilkinson and his coaches have done a great job at the club.

"Their players played very well and have a lot of potential."

Outstanding for Auckland City FC were defenders Jesse Gage, Marcel Stoddard and, of course, Thomas Holmes, whose goal was top drawer.

"That was Thomas first start for the U-23s in a league game and did very well in midfield," Bright said.

Another player for whom it was a big day was Liam Quinn back after two years out with injury.

"It was good to see Liam come back particularly after what he's been through. I thought he did very well," he added.
